在数字化浪潮席卷全球的今天,数据已成为企业的核心资产与生命线。然而,频发的数据泄漏事件——从内部员工无意泄露到外部黑客恶意攻击——不断为企业敲响警钟。传统的网络安全边界防护(如防火墙、入侵检测)在应对内部威胁和终端数据窃取时往往力不从心。此时,聚焦于数据本身,在文件生成、存储、流转的最终环节实施保护,便显得至关重要。而“加密文件夹源代码”正是这一理念下,一种极具实操性的终端数据防泄漏落地方案。它并非一个泛泛而谈的概念,而是指通过一套完整的、可部署的源代码程序,在企业终端计算机上创建受高强度加密保护的虚拟文件夹或磁盘区域,对所有存入其中的文件进行自动、透明的加密,从而实现数据在“最后一公里”的主动防护。 核心价值:从“防边界”到“护数据”的范式转变传统安全模型类似于“城堡与护城河”,假设内部是可信的。但在内部威胁、设备丢失、权限滥用等场景下,该模型极易失效。加密文件夹源代码方案的核心价值在于实现了安全范式的转变:从保护网络和系统,转向直接保护数据本身。 *主动加密,无关位置:一旦文件被存入加密文件夹,无论其被复制到U盘、通过邮件发送、还是上传至网盘,只要脱离了解密环境,便是一堆无法识别的密文。这从根本上解决了数据离开可控环境后的安全问题。 *权限最小化与访问控制:该方案通常集成严格的访问控制机制。只有经过授权的用户(通过密码、数字证书、生物特征等方式)才能挂载并访问加密文件夹的内容。这实现了对敏感数据访问权限的精细化管控,符合“最小权限原则”。 *应对内部威胁的有效工具:据统计,超过60%的数据泄漏事件与内部人员有关。加密文件夹源代码可以对不同部门、项目组的敏感数据(如财务报告、设计图纸、源代码、客户名单)进行隔离加密。即使拥有系统访问权限的员工,也无法绕过加密机制查看非授权数据,极大降低了内部恶意窃取或无意泄露的风险。 技术架构与落地实现详解一套完整、可落地的“加密文件夹源代码”方案,其技术实现通常包含以下几个关键模块,这些模块的协同工作确保了安全性与易用性的平衡。 #驱动层加密与虚拟文件系统这是方案的基石。源代码中会包含一个运行在操作系统内核层的过滤驱动或文件系统驱动。其工作原理是: 1.拦截I/O请求:当应用程序尝试对加密文件夹内的文件进行读写操作时,驱动层会率先拦截该请求。 2.实时加解密:对于写操作,驱动在数据写入磁盘前,使用指定的加密算法(如AES-256)对其进行实时加密。对于读操作,驱动从磁盘读取密文数据后,在传递给应用程序前进行实时解密。 3.对用户透明:整个过程对授权用户和应用程序完全透明。用户感觉像是在操作一个普通文件夹,所有加解密动作均在后台自动完成。这种透明性是保证员工工作效率、推动方案顺利落地的重要前提。 #灵活的密钥管理体系密钥是加密系统的命门。一个健壮的源代码方案必须包含一套安全的密钥管理逻辑: *用户口令派生密钥:最常见的方式是使用用户输入的强口令,通过PBKDF2、Scrypt等密钥派生函数生成加密主密钥。这种方式无需额外硬件,部署简单。 *双因子认证增强:对于更高安全要求,可集成硬件令牌、智能卡或Windows域认证作为第二因子,实现双因子密钥解锁。 *企业级密钥托管:在企业环境中,源代码应支持将密钥托管至 centralized 密钥管理服务器。这样,管理员可以在员工忘记密码或离职时恢复数据,同时确保个人无法绕过企业监管。 #加密文件夹的创建与管理模块这是用户直接交互的部分。源代码应提供友好的管理界面或命令行工具,实现以下功能: *创建/销毁加密卷:指定位置、大小、加密算法(AES, Serpent等)和哈希算法。 *动态挂载与卸载:授权用户输入凭证后,将加密卷挂载为一个虚拟磁盘(如Z:盘)或虚拟文件夹。工作结束后可卸载,此时该虚拟驱动器消失,数据在磁盘上仍处于加密状态。 *便携卷功能:支持创建可在不同电脑间移动的“便携式加密卷”,方便安全的数据携带与交换。 #审计与日志记录模块为了满足合规性要求和事后追溯,源代码需包含详细的日志功能,记录所有关键事件,如:加密卷的创建、挂载、卸载、失败登录尝试、密钥更改等。这些日志应被安全地传输至中央日志服务器进行分析。 在企业环境中的部署与集成策略要让“加密文件夹源代码”从代码变为企业有效的安全防线,需要周密的部署策略。 1.试点与分级部署:首先在IT、研发、财务等核心敏感部门进行试点,收集反馈,优化策略。随后根据数据敏感级别,在全公司范围分级部署,而非一刀切。 2.与现有体系集成: *与AD/LDAP集成:实现使用公司域账号直接认证挂载加密文件夹,简化用户操作,统一身份管理。 *与DLP系统联动:作为数据防泄漏体系的一环,加密文件夹可与网络DLP、终端DLP互补。DLP系统负责发现和监控敏感数据,而加密文件夹负责为已识别的敏感数据提供最终的存储保护。 *纳入终端管理:通过企业移动管理或统一终端管理平台,批量分发加密客户端、配置策略和密钥。 3.制定明确的使用策略:规定哪些类别的数据必须存入加密文件夹(如“商业秘密”、“个人身份信息”、“项目核心设计”),并将其作为员工信息安全培训与合规要求的一部分。 潜在挑战与应对之道任何技术方案的落地都不会一帆风顺,加密文件夹源代码亦然。 *性能损耗:实时加解密会带来一定的I/O性能开销。应对之道包括选择高效的加密算法(如AES-NI硬件加速)、优化驱动代码,并向用户说明安全与性能之间的必要权衡。 *用户接受度与误操作:用户可能因嫌麻烦而规避使用。需要通过持续培训,强调其重要性,并尽可能简化操作流程。同时,需防范用户忘记密码或丢失密钥导致数据永久丢失的风险,通过企业密钥托管机制来规避。 *系统兼容性与稳定性:内核驱动需与不同版本的操作系统(包括Windows、macOS、Linux)及各类应用软件深度兼容,确保系统稳定不蓝屏。这要求源代码具备高质量的代码和充分的测试。 结论:构建以数据为中心的安全基石面对日益严峻的数据安全形势,企业需要构筑纵深防御体系。加密文件夹源代码方案,正是这个防御体系中贴近数据、贴近终端、贴近业务的关键一层。它通过源代码级别的自主可控,赋予企业根据自身需求定制化开发、深度集成和持续演进的能力,避免了商业黑盒产品的捆绑与局限。 将核心敏感数据置于加密文件夹的保护之下,相当于为数据穿上了“防弹衣”。无论这份数据位于员工的笔记本电脑、移动硬盘,还是通过非受控渠道流转,其密文状态都能有效抵御外部窃取和内部越权访问。落地“加密文件夹源代码”,不仅是部署一项技术工具,更是推动企业安全文化从“被动防护”向“主动免疫”、从“保护边界”到“保护数据本身”深刻转变的务实一步,为企业数字化业务的稳健航行筑牢最底层的安全基石。 |
| ·上一条:加密数字货币源代码安全防泄漏全攻略:从核心机制到企业级落地实践 | ·下一条:加密核心源代码:构筑企业数据安全的最后防线与实战部署 |